Amid riots in France, rioters looted gun shops, cleaned their hands on rifles as well


France Riots: In France, on June 27, traffic police shot a 17-year-old boy named Nahel M, of Algerian origin, against which riots have spread across the country. So far 875 people have been arrested in the riots. At the same time, about 500 houses were damaged.

During the riots in France, there were arson and explosions in many places. An explosion rocked the old port area of ​​Marseille and city officials said they did not believe there were any casualties. Police said rioters looted a gun shop in central Marseille and stole some hunting rifles. Fire services were having difficulty reaching the scene as the streets were on fire.

An incident that engulfed the whole of France

France has been facing tremendous riots for the last 4 days. For this, a large number of police officers have been deployed on the streets to deal with the riots in France. French Home Minister Gerald Darmanin told broadcaster TF1 that the government had deployed 45,000 police officers on Friday (June 30) evening to deal with the current situation.

Violent protests began in Paris, the fashion capital, after a boy of Algerian origin was shot dead in France. It engulfed the whole of France.

social media attack
French President Emmanuel Macron said that social media is promoting violence. He told the agencies that sensitive things should be removed from platforms like Snapchat and Tiktok soon. He has condemned the situation arising in the case of the death of the juvenile. He has said that additional security forces will be deployed to stop the riots.
